Large Murano blown glass pendant light LS185 by Carlo Nason for Mazzega. Born in 1935 in Murano, Carlo Nason comes from a family of expert glassmakers. His father, Vincenzo Nason, also ran the famous NasonMoretti company. Raised in this environment from a young age, Carlo began designing molded-blown vases in 1959, which are now kept at the Corning Museum of Glass in New York. Wanting to go it alone, away from the family business, he was spotted by AV Mazzega (who produced this pendant light), another famous glass manufacturer, with whom he collaborated from 1965 to 1980 on a range of lamps and various lighting fixtures. His creations are now part of many art and design galleries and museums in Paris, Milan and New York.
